Rise and Drop Provided by Shank Included with Curt C17500 TruTrack Weight Distribution System
Question:
I have a curt hitch with about a 4” rise to level our trailer. Does this system have height adjustment?
asked by: Jon S
Helpful Expert Reply:
I'm assuming in order to properly level your trailer, you're needing a weight distrubution shank to have at least a 4 inch rise. If that's the case, the shank included with the Curt # C17500 TruTrack provides up to a 6 inch rise, which should work well for you. If you needed a drop, the shank provides up to 1/2 inch drop.
Longer shanks are available, part # 17120 will give up to a 5-3/4 inch drop or a 10 inch rise. # C17122 will give up to a 7 inch drop or a 10-1/2 inch rise.
